System and method for programming a clinical device
First Claim
1. A system for programming a clinical device to deliver medication to a patient, the system comprising:
- a first processor in operable communication with the clinical device;
input means operatively connected to the first processor for input of identification data to the first processor;
a second processor having a memory in which is stored information related to the delivery of medication to the patient, including identification data;
a means for communicating information related to the delivery of medication to the patient between the first and second processors, the information including identification data and clinical device operating parameters;
wherein identification data input into the first processor is compared to the stored identification data by either the first or second processor and the second processor downloads clinical device operating parameters to the first processor to program and operate the clinical device in accordance with the downloaded operating parameters if the comparison of the identification data satisfies a predetermined condition.

Abstract
A care management system in which the management of the administration of care for patients is automated. Hospital information systems are monitored and the information from those systems is used in verifying the administrations of care to patients. The care management system monitors ongoing administrations for progress and automatically updates records and provides alarms when necessary. The care management system is modular in nature but is fully integrated among its modules. Particular lists of data, such as the termination times of all ongoing infusions, provide hospital staff current information for increased accuracy and efficiency in planning. Features include the automatic provision of infusion parameters to pumps for accurate and efficient configuration of the pump, and providing an alarm when an unscheduled suspension of an infusion exceeds a predetermined length of time. A passive recognition system for identifying patients and care givers is provided.
